The context of the call
The owner contacted us after noticing that his Trane heat pump, although robust and renowned for its durability, was producing lukewarm air in heating mode and insufficiently cold air in cooling mode . He also noticed that the outdoor fan was starting irregularly , and that the system seemed to be "forcing" more than usual.
Installed for over ten years against a brick wall typical of single-family homes in Brossard , the heat pump was surrounded by dense vegetation, which partially obstructed the condenser ventilation. These conditions could easily lead to compressor overheating and a drop in energy efficiency .
Inspection and diagnosis
Upon our arrival, our technician carried out a complete analysis of the system :
-
Visual inspection and cleaning
-
The condenser was covered with dust, pollen and plant debris , restricting airflow.
-
Branches were directly touching the upper grille, obstructing heat dissipation.
-
-
Checking the refrigeration circuit
-
Measurement of pressures and temperatures of R22 refrigerant.
-
Results: Abnormal low pressure indicated partial loss of refrigerant.
-
-
Electrical and mechanical analysis
-
Fan capacitor check: capacity weakened to 40% of nominal value.
-
Compressor test: resistance within normal ranges, no short circuit detected.
-
-
Control board test
-
Correct reading of signals, but slight oxidation on the connectors due to ambient humidity.
-
The final diagnosis revealed a minor leak in a coil weld , combined with an aging capacitor and lack of maintenance around the outdoor unit .
Steps of repair
1. Thorough cleaning of the condenser
-
Removal of surrounding vegetation to provide a ventilation space of at least 60 cm all around the unit.
-
Thorough cleaning of the condenser fins using a non-corrosive product and low pressure rinsing.
-
Straightening folded fins to maximize airflow.
2. Repair the leak and recharge with refrigerant
-
Leak detection using a UV tracer and re-welding of the defective joint using a torch and silver solder.
-
Complete vacuuming of the circuit to eliminate all traces of humidity.
-
Recharge the system with a compatible R22 replacement refrigerant , as recommended by Trane.
3. Replacing the starting capacitor
-
Installation of a new 45/5 µF capacitor , calibrated for the XL1200 series motor and compressor.
-
Secure fixing and prime test of the compressor.
-
Checking voltages, currents and phase sequences.
4. Final performance test
-
In air conditioning mode: blowing temperature measured at 8°C , in accordance with original specifications.
-
In heating mode: blowing at 38°C , demonstrating restored energy efficiency.
-
No abnormal noise, vibrations eliminated and pressures stabilized.

An essential reminder for central heat pump owners
Units like the Trane XL1200 , while robust, can lose up to 20% efficiency when dirty or poorly ventilated. Preventative maintenance is therefore essential to:
-
avoid excessive electricity consumption,
-
prevent compressor overheating,
-
and maintain performance season after season.
